Metabolic plasticity maintains proliferation in pyruvate dehydrogenase deficient cells

BACKGROUND: Pyruvate dehydrogenase (PDH) occupies a central node of intermediary metabolism, converting pyruvate to acetyl-CoA, thus committing carbon derived from glucose to an aerobic fate rather than an anaerobic one.
